Market Opportunity in the United States

The United States represents one of the largest and most diversified markets in the world for footwear and leather goods. With a population exceeding 330 million people and strong purchasing power across multiple consumer segments, demand for quality footwear and leather products remains consistently high.

The U.S. market includes a broad spectrum of product categories, ranging from everyday footwear and fashion accessories to specialized segments such as work and safety footwear, orthopedic footwear, outdoor and performance products, as well as premium leather goods including bags, belts, wallets, and travel accessories.

Despite the scale and attractiveness of the market, many international manufacturers of footwear and leather goods face structural challenges when attempting to establish a stable presence in the United States. Entry pathways are often fragmented and dependent on multiple intermediaries, complex import procedures, and distribution networks that provide limited long-term market visibility.

As a result, many manufacturers from Europe, Southeast Europe, and North Africa rely on indirect export arrangements that reduce margins, limit brand positioning, and create unpredictable commercial outcomes.

The Globe Footwear & Leather Land™ Megacenter Concept

A central element of the long-term vision behind GLOBE FOOTWEAR & LEATHER LAND™ is the development of a large-scale industry and retail megacenter dedicated exclusively to footwear and leather goods.

The concept envisions a specialized facility of approximately 50,000 square meters designed to bring together international manufacturers, brands, distributors, and buyers within a single physical and commercial environment. Rather than functioning as a traditional shopping center, the megacenter is intended to operate as a hybrid platform combining retail presence, industry representation, and commercial interaction.

Within this environment, manufacturers of footwear and leather goods will have the opportunity to present their products through dedicated showroom spaces, brand zones, and specialized product segments. The facility will also support business-to-business activities by providing structured access for buyers, distributors, and retail partners seeking new suppliers and product categories.

In addition to commercial functions, the megacenter is designed to support industry development through spaces dedicated to product presentation, design innovation, and educational initiatives related to materials, craftsmanship, and manufacturing technologies.
